#d19bcd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d19bcd is composed of 82% red, 60.8%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.8%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 304.4 degrees, a saturation of 37% and a lightness of 71.4%. #d19bcd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a3379b.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#d19bcd color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#d19bcd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d19bcd has RGB values of R:209, G:155,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.02,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13736909.
